买的VPS怎么使用?新手入门指南与常见问题解答
| 步骤 |
操作内容 |
工具/命令 |
说明 |
| 1 |
获取VPS登录信息 |
邮箱/控制台 |
购买后提供商通常会发送SSH地址、用户名和密码 |
| 2 |
连接VPS |
SSH客户端(如PuTTY) |
使用ssh username@ipaddress命令连接 |
| 3 |
基础配置 |
终端命令 |
包括更新系统sudo apt update && upgrade、设置防火墙等 |
| 4 |
安装必要软件 |
包管理器 |
如Web服务器(Nginx/Apache)、数据库(MySQL)等 |
| 5 |
部署应用 |
FTP/SFTP或Git |
上传网站文件或通过版本控制部署 |
买的VPS怎么使用?从连接到部署的完整操作指南
一、VPS使用前的准备工作
在开始使用VPS之前,您需要完成以下准备工作:
- 获取登录凭证:购买VPS后,服务商通常会通过邮件发送SSH地址、用户名和初始密码。部分服务商提供控制台直接查看这些信息。
- 准备连接工具:
- Windows用户推荐使用PuTTY或MobaXterm
- macOS/Linux用户可直接使用终端自带的SSH客户端
- 确认网络环境:确保本地网络允许SSH连接(默认端口22),部分企业网络可能需要特殊配置。
二、连接VPS的详细步骤
- 打开SSH客户端:
- PuTTY用户:在"Host Name"处输入VPS的IP地址,端口保持默认22
- 终端用户:执行命令:
ssh username@yourvpsip
- 首次连接验证:
- 会提示验证服务器指纹,确认无误后输入"yes"
- 输入初始密码(输入时不可见,输完直接回车)
- 首次登录建议:
- 立即修改默认密码
- 创建SSH密钥对替代密码登录(更安全)
三、VPS基础配置指南
连接成功后,建议按顺序完成以下基础配置:
- 系统更新:
sudo apt update && sudo apt upgrade -y # Debian/Ubuntu
sudo yum update -y # CentOS
- 防火墙设置(以UFirewall为例):
sudo apt install ufw
sudo ufw allow ssh
sudo ufw enable
- 时区设置:
sudo timedatectl set-timezone Asia/Shanghai
四、常见问题解决方案
| 问题现象 |
可能原因 |
解决方法 |
| SSH连接超时 |
防火墙阻止/网络问题 |
检查服务商控制台安全组设置,确认VPS状态 |
| 登录提示”Permission denied” |
密码错误/SSH配置问题 |
重置密码或检查/etc/ssh/sshdconfig文件 |
| 系统更新失败 |
软件源配置错误 |
更换国内镜像源(如阿里云、清华源) |
| 网站无法访问 |
Web服务未启动/端口未开放 |
检查Nginx/Apache状态systemctl status nginx |
五、进阶使用建议
- 环境管理:使用Docker容器化部署应用,避免环境冲突
- 监控设置:安装
htop、nmon等工具监控资源使用情况
- 定期备份:配置crontab自动备份重要数据到对象存储
- 安全加固:禁用root登录、设置fail2ban防暴力破解
通过以上步骤,您应该已经能够基本掌握VPS的使用方法。根据实际需求,您可以进一步学习特定服务的配置,如搭建网站、部署数据库等。遇到具体问题时,建议查阅相关服务的官方文档或社区论坛获取更专业的指导。
发表评论